Hate to burst your bubble but *I* have a better chance of carrying MA than Trump does...

I get tired of that defeatism. No wonder Republicans have a hard time winning national elections when they so willingly "spot" the Democrats a ton of electoral votes and not even try for them.

The reason this annoys me is that as a result of this pessimism, it becomes a self-fulfilling prophecy. People in Massachusetts (and other states that people like you want to surrender to the Democrats) that would normally come out to vote for a Republican candidate stay home when they are told that their votes don't matter because the state is a lost cause anyway. Then the Democrat will win by 20-25 points, allowing people like you to smugly tell us "I told you so" and there is even less hope for the next election cycle.

I do not like this death spiral of negativity that we are in.

Had Ronald Reagan only campaigned in a handful of swing states during 1980 because the polls had him down nationally, I doubt very much he would have had the landslide he had. Maybe he would have still won but it would not have been the mandate that it was.

I do not believe in focusing a presidential campaign on just a handful of swing states and ignoring the rest of the country. That is a recipe for electoral failure in my opinion.

If the Republicans are going to start turning blue states red, they are going to have to make a play for them. Also, they cannot afford to take for granted states that are "safe." I was glad to see Donald Trump in Texas the other day. His strongest supporters deserve rallies and attention as well.

This is a national election. We are not just electing a president for Ohio, Florida and Pennsylvania.
